Tuttosport: When Milan will begin Camarda talks as top European clubs observe

Francesco Camarda’s rise continues to attract a lot of attention, and the AC Milan management know that securing his future long-term is a priority.

Today’s edition of Tuttosport (via PianetaMilan) takes stock of the issue of renewals at Milan including that of Mike Maignan but also Camarda, who is now a fully established part of Ignazio Abate’s Primavera side despite being just 15.

In March, when Camarda reaches the age of 16, Milan will enter into discussions with the entourage of the striker knowing that he is already being looked at by many top European clubs.

For the Rossoneri they see it as very important to try and tie down Camarda, given the obvious potential he has to become not just the No.9 of the future – with the right patience – but also one of the future beacons for Italy.

Until March though the teenager will continue focusing on the field and on scoring goals to help Abate and his side.
